Understanding DEVOPS: A Comprehensive Guide
What is DEVOPS?
DEVOPS is a cultural and professional movement that emphasizes collaboration between software developers and IT operations professionals. It aims to help organizations produce software and IT services more rapidly, with better quality, and greater efficiency.
Key Principles of DEVOPS
- Collaboration and Communication
- Automation of Processes
- Continuous Integration and Continuous Delivery (CI/CD)
- Monitoring and Feedback
Benefits of Implementing DEVOPS
Implementing DEVOPS can bring numerous benefits to an organization, including:
- Increased Deployment Frequency
- Faster Time to Market
- Improved Collaboration Between Teams
- Enhanced Quality and Reliability
DEVOPS Tools and Practices
Some popular tools used in DEVOPS practices include:
| Tool | Purpose |
|---|---|
| Docker | Containerization |
| Jenkins | Continuous Integration |
| Kubernetes | Container Orchestration |
Getting Started with DEVOPS
To effectively implement DEVOPS in your organization, consider enrolling in comprehensive training programs. For instance, you can explore DEVOPS training in Vizag to gain insights and practical skills.
Frequently Asked Questions (FAQ)
What is the main goal of DEVOPS?
The main goal of DEVOPS is to improve collaboration between development and operations teams to enhance productivity and efficiency in software delivery.
How does DEVOPS improve software quality?
By incorporating practices like continuous testing and integration, DEVOPS helps identify and fix issues early in the development process, leading to improved software quality.
Is DEVOPS suitable for all types of organizations?
Yes, DEVOPS principles can be adapted to fit organizations of all sizes and industries that are looking to improve their software development processes.
Conclusion
DEVOPS is transforming the way organizations approach software development and IT operations. By adopting its principles, businesses can achieve faster delivery times, better collaboration, and improved software quality.